Visakhapatnam vs Chicago, Illinois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Visakhapatnam, India and Chicago, Illinois, Usa is approximately 13,335 km or 8,287 mi.
  • To reach Visakhapatnam in this distance one would set out from Chicago, Illinois bearing 9.8°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Visakhapatnam bearing 172.3° or S .
  • Visakhapatnam has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Chicago, Illinois has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
  • Visakhapatnam is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Chicago, Illinois is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 17.9 °C (32.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.1 °C (34.4°F) less in Visakhapatnam.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 112 mm (4.4 in) more which is equivalent to 112 l/m² (2.75 US gal/ft²) or 1,120,000 l/ha (119,735 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.2° higher in Visakhapatnam than in Chicago, Illinois.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.6%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 19.9°C (35.8°F) higher.
